After notification by the owning entity, the County <br /> Engineer shall inspect and approve the completed improvements. <br /> d) Appeals <br /> Any requirement, decision or determination of the County Engineer may be <br /> appealed to the Board of Commissioners for consideration at its next available <br /> regular meeting. <br /> 6.23.8 PLACEMENT OF STREETS, DRIVEWAYS AND BUILDINGS <br /> Streets, driveways, and buildings or other structures shall be located, to the extent <br /> reasonable possible, so as to take full advantage of the absorptive capacity of the soils <br /> on which they are to be situated and to avoid the following environmentally sensitive <br /> areas: <br /> 1) Stream buffer zones as required by Article 6.23.10; <br /> 2) Wetlands as defined by the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ers; <br /> 3) Land with slopes greater than fifteen percent (15%); and <br /> 4) Natural areas as identified in the Inventory of Natural Areas and Wildlife Habitats <br /> of Orange County. NC. <br /> To avoid creating lots that will be difficult to build upon in compliance with the standards <br /> of this Article, the subdivision plats shall show proposed building envelopes and <br /> approximate driveway locations for all lots within such subdivisions. Thereafter, no <br /> zoning compliance permit may be issued for the construction of buildings or driveways <br /> outside the areas so designated on the preliminary plat unless the Zoning Officer makes <br /> a written finding that the proposed location complies with the provisions of this Article. <br /> 6.23.9 UNDISTURBED AREA <br /> Because soils which are seriously disturbed, even if re-vegetated, can generate nearly as <br /> much run-off as paved areas, a portion of property being developed within watershed <br /> critical areas must remain undisturbed during construction. <br /> 14 <br />
